Abstract: To combine multilevel code (MLC) with differential space-time modulation (DSTM), a new scheme based on an multilevel low-density parity-check (LDPC) code with iterative decoding is proposed.This scheme has lower decoding complexity compared to conventional MLC schemes using more than one channel coders.To avoid excessive error feedback that may cause decoding failure, both outer and inner iterations are used.The scheme uses LDPC codes as a criterion to terminate both iterations so as to further reduce the average decoding complexity.Simulation results for a quasi-stationary fading MIMO channel show that the proposed scheme is effective.
Key words: multilevel coding, differential space-time modulation, combined coding modulation, low-density parity-check
